As of May 2026, the average rent in Atlantic City, NJ is $2,000 per month, which is 4% higher than the national average rent of $1,930 per month.

As of May 2026, apartments are the most affordable rental option in Atlantic City, NJ at $1,777 per month, while houses are the most expensive at $2,450 per month. Townhomes average $2,350 per month, offering a mid-range alternative for renters.

As of May 2026, the average rent for a 1 bedroom rental in Atlantic City, NJ is $1,600 per month, followed by $1,800 for a 2 bedroom rental, $2,300 for a 3 bedroom rental, and $4,510 for a 4 bedroom rental.
